## Step 4: Apply cache invalidation settings

Following the Quillhaven stale-cache postmortem, the Lanternfish service now requires explicit TTL bounds before migration can proceed. The root cause was a fallback path that served expired entries when the revalidation worker stalled; the fix enforces a hard ceiling and a mandatory purge on deploy. Security review should confirm the purge credential is scoped read-write only on the cache namespace. The values below reflect the post-incident hardened configuration.

service settings:
PRAWYN_PIN=9848
PRAWYN_METRICS_HOST=metrics.prawyn.lumicworks.corp
PRAWYN_LOG_LEVEL=warn
PRAWYN_TENANT=pelius

**Vendor note: Inkmill markdown pipeline**

Rendering for Parchway docs is outsourced to Inkmill under an annual contract, renewing each March. They handle sanitization and PDF export; we own the upload queue. SLA: 4-hour response on rendering failures. Escalate only after two failed retries. Their support desk is reachable at the address below.

billing contact of hahaf-baguf = zorael.tammir.jorius@sivrelhq.internal

## Local Setup

SplitPane is our diff viewer for files over 500 MB. Clone the repo, run `make bootstrap`, and start the chunk indexer with `bin/indexer --local`. The viewer streams diffs from a Postgres-backed chunk cache; no files are held fully in memory. For review purposes, the cache schema is read-only at runtime. Point the indexer at the cache using the connection string below.

primary connection of kahof-kagep = mssql://belath_svc:3uqY4g6LHG5Nyi@db-d0ba.ferralabs.corp:5432/rusdor

## Catalogue Import — Step 3

Once the Brindlewick Library export file lands in the staging folder, run the Shelfwright importer in dry-run mode first. Check the summary for duplicate accession numbers; anything over 50 duplicates means the branch sent a full dump instead of a delta, so stop and ping the data team. If the dry run is clean, rerun without the flag. The field mapping reference lives here:

operations page: https://confluence.tolvaqsys.corp/spaces/pages/pages/6e787158f507